    Hello everyone, this might have been asked before but I’m not exactly sure what the problem is. I’m learning animation and i did a simple animation and rendered it out into png frames. The next step is to import the pictures into premiere to make a movie. I set the right sequence settings and changed the default image still duration from 5 seconds to 1 frame. But when i drag a image from the project file panel to the time line it is still 5 sec.

    Im on the latest version of creative cloud. Any ideas what i’m doing wrong?

    Changing still duration in the Pref. is done before import.
    However you can rightclick on the image in the Project Window and select Speed/Duration.
